Excel表格网

sql累加字段数

277 2024-03-01 21:41 admin   手机版

SQL累加字段数是数据库查询中一个常见的需求,通常用于计算累加或累积字段的值。在SQL语句中,我们可以通过不同的方法来实现对字段值的累加操作,这在数据分析和报告生成中非常有用。本文将介绍几种常见的实现方式,帮助您更好地理解如何在SQL查询中处理累加字段数的需求。

使用SUM函数

最常见且简单的方法是使用SQL中的SUM函数来计算字段值的累加总和。通过将需要累加的字段作为SUM函数的参数,我们可以轻松地得到累加字段数的结果。

使用变量进行累加

另一种常见的方法是使用SQL中的变量来进行累加操作。通过声明一个变量,并在每次迭代中更新变量的数值,我们可以实现对字段值的逐行累加。

利用窗口函数

窗口函数是在SQL中执行类似累加操作的有力工具。通过使用OVER子句和合适的窗口规范,我们可以在不对查询结果进行分组的情况下计算字段的累加值。

使用CASE语句

在某些情况下,我们可能需要根据某些条件来决定是否累加字段数。这时可以使用CASE语句来对不同的情况进行处理,从而实现灵活的字段累加逻辑。

结合子查询

如果需要在一个查询中实现多个字段的累加操作,可以考虑使用子查询。通过在主查询中引用子查询的结果,我们可以方便地对多个字段进行累加计算。

总结

在SQL查询中处理sql累加字段数的需求并不复杂,通过合理选择不同的方法,我们可以轻松地实现字段值的累加操作。无论是使用SUM函数、变量、窗口函数还是CASE语句,都可以根据具体情况选择适合的解决方案。希望本文对您理解如何处理SQL中的字段累加需求有所帮助。

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
用户名: 验证码:点击我更换图片
上一篇:返回栏目